Discover one of Earth's most extraordinary rainforest mammals in Tree Kangaroo Handbook, a professional and deeply educational guide to the biology, behavior, habitat, and conservation of tree kangaroos-kangaroos that evolved to live and thrive high in the forest canopy.

Unlike ground-dwelling kangaroos, tree kangaroos are powerful climbers with specialized limbs, gripping claws, and balancing tails designed for life in tropical rainforests. Found mainly in New Guinea and parts of northeastern Australia, these rare marsupials play an important role in forest ecosystems through leaf browsing, seed dispersal, and supporting rainforest regeneration. Yet today, many tree kangaroo species face serious threats from habitat loss, hunting pressures, and environmental change.
